Getty ImagesApple has suspended a new artificial intelligence (AI) feature that drew criticism and complaints for making repeated mistakes in its summaries of news headlines. The tech giant had been facing mounting pressure to withdraw the service, which sent notifications that appeared to come from within news organisations’ apps. “We are working on improvements and will make them available in a future software update,” an Apple spokesperson said. Journalism body Reporters Without Borders (RSF) said it showed the dangers of rushing out new features.”Innovation must never come at the expense of the right of citizens to receive reliable information,” it…
Raids to detain and deport migrants living in the US without permission are set to begin on the first full day of the new Trump administration, US media report.The operations – threatened by Donald Trump’s “border tsar” Tom Homan – could begin in Chicago, a city with a large migrant population, as early as Tuesday, the New York Times and Wall Street Journal say.Trump has said he will oversee the largest deportation programme in US history.In an interview with Fox News this week, Homan promised a “big raid” across the country. He has previously said Chicago will be “ground zero”…

13 January 2025, 1:47 pm 1 minute Reuters exclusively reported that the German government is weighing selling its entire 99% holding of German utility Uniper, which has a market capitalisation of nearly $19 billion. The government had flagged previously only a minority exit on the public markets. Reuters was also first to reveal that the government had reached out to potential buyers to discuss a full sale, including Canadian fund Brookfield. A full sale to a private equity fund would be one of Europe’s biggest in recent years. Why it matters Uniper nearly collapsed after its former main gas…
15 The island of Bali, Indonesia was visited by more than 6 million international tourists in 2024, and it’s one of the most popular travel destination in Southeast Asia. But how safe is it? The short answer to this question is that Bali is very safe. It’s safer than most places in the world. I’d also happily recommend it to families and solo travelers. However, the long answer is a bit more nuanced and there are at least a few good things you should know before you go to Bali. In this blog post, I’ll address some common safety questions…

David Lammy was visiting Washington last May when he realised Donald Trump was likely to win the presidential election. The soon-to-be foreign secretary held meetings with the Democrat and Republican campaigns – and found himself admiring the latter.The slickness and professionalism of Trump’s 2024 operation, with its sharp messaging making inroads with black and Hispanic voters, seemed a far cry from his shambolic 2016 campaign. By comparison, Joe Biden’s appeared backward-looking and focused on attacking Trump’s record, while lacking a compelling narrative of its own.Fast forward eight months, and Trump is days away from being inaugurated as president for the…
Getty ImagesThe Brihadishvara temple, built in the 11th Century by King Rajaraja Chola, is a Unesco World Heritage siteIt’s 1000 CE – the heart of the Middle Ages.Europe is in flux. The powerful nations we know today – like Norman-ruled England and the fragmented territories that will go on to become France – do not yet exist. Towering Gothic cathedrals have yet to rise. Aside from the distant and prosperous city of Constantinople, few great urban centres dominate the landscape.Yet that year, on the other side of the globe, an emperor from southern India was preparing to build the world’s…
